
Aaryan G. developed and refined multiple exploitation modules for the rapid7/metasploit-framework repository, focusing on real-world vulnerabilities such as WordPress Perfect Survey SQL injection and Online Car Rental System remote code execution. He combined deep vulnerability research with robust Ruby and Ruby on Rails engineering, delivering modules with comprehensive documentation and reproducible setup instructions. His work emphasized code quality through RuboCop and MsfTidy-driven refactoring, improving maintainability and onboarding for future contributors. By streamlining payload execution, clarifying result types, and enhancing HTTP file upload handling, Aaryan ensured more predictable exploit workflows and reduced misconfiguration risks, demonstrating a strong commitment to secure, maintainable code.
May 2025 monthly summary for rapid7/metasploit-framework: Delivered targeted feature refinements to the Online Car Rental System exploit module and improved reliability of the carrental upload flow. Key features include refactoring the Online Car Rental System exploit (removing an unused option, clarifying the check result type, and not storing the response to streamline payload execution) and enhancing HTTP file upload handling in carrental (separating the file ID from the main path, explicitly setting Content-Type, and simplifying the upload success check). Major bugs fixed and quality improvements include RuboCop style cleanup in carrental_fileupload_rce.rb and general code hygiene improvements (MsfTidy fixes). Overall impact: more predictable exploit workflows, reduced risk of misconfigurations, and stronger maintainability for future feature work. Technologies demonstrated: Ruby, RuboCop, HTTP handling, payload execution optimization, and rigorous code quality practices.
May 2025 monthly summary for rapid7/metasploit-framework: Delivered targeted feature refinements to the Online Car Rental System exploit module and improved reliability of the carrental upload flow. Key features include refactoring the Online Car Rental System exploit (removing an unused option, clarifying the check result type, and not storing the response to streamline payload execution) and enhancing HTTP file upload handling in carrental (separating the file ID from the main path, explicitly setting Content-Type, and simplifying the upload success check). Major bugs fixed and quality improvements include RuboCop style cleanup in carrental_fileupload_rce.rb and general code hygiene improvements (MsfTidy fixes). Overall impact: more predictable exploit workflows, reduced risk of misconfigurations, and stronger maintainability for future feature work. Technologies demonstrated: Ruby, RuboCop, HTTP handling, payload execution optimization, and rigorous code quality practices.
April 2025 monthly work summary for rapid7/metasploit-framework focusing on delivering exploit development capabilities and improving code quality.
April 2025 monthly work summary for rapid7/metasploit-framework focusing on delivering exploit development capabilities and improving code quality.
In December 2024, the metasploit-framework contributed two high-impact exploitation modules plus substantial code quality improvements, delivering measurable business value for security testing and operational readiness.
In December 2024, the metasploit-framework contributed two high-impact exploitation modules plus substantial code quality improvements, delivering measurable business value for security testing and operational readiness.

Overview of all repositories you've contributed to across your timeline